New York City Police Department crime scene investigators swab for evidence outside the One Carnegie Hill luxury rental apartment complex located at 215 E. 96th Street, which is around the corner from where former Governor of New York David Paterson and his 20-year-old son are injured by five suspects during a gang assault at approximately 8:30 p.m. in front of 1871 2nd Avenue on the Upper East Side of Manhattan, New York, United States, on October 4, 2024. The NYPD releases an image of the suspects wanted for the assault on social media and asks for the public's assistance in identifying them. (Photo by Kyle Mazza/NurPhoto)
